This sounds like a relay stuck on. Don't know, but is
it the cigarette lighter or headlights relays? 90 Accords
and up use relays for both. What ever the relay, you
must be able to pinpoint it, swap it or bench test it to
see if it's the problem.

> I even tried pulling the fuses


There's no easy fuse to pull for the alternator. The
300-ma drain probably just the relay.
